Summary

The emergence of powerful AI models like Mythos creates a dual-use dilemma in cybersecurity, acting as both a superior shield and a potent weapon. Vincent Laurens explores how automated vulnerability discovery necessitates a new framework for defense and regulation.

Highlights

  • Main idea: AI models like Mythos accelerate the discovery of both known and unknown vulnerabilities, intensifying the arms race between hackers and defenders
  • Failure mode: Relying on human-speed testing is no longer sufficient as AI can automate complex penetration tests at unprecedented speeds
  • Practical takeaway: Organizations must prioritize cybersecurity hygiene, specifically regular patching and automated configuration management
  • Strategic takeaway: Effective defense requires 'augmented governance'—using AI agents to monitor, detect, and deploy fixes in real-time
  • Critical necessity: A structured regulatory framework is needed to manage how discovered vulnerabilities are communicated and remediated without fear of legal retaliation
